Sub(Function(:)) Posted February 18, 2008 Share Posted February 18, 2008 AFAIK You need a set of UK TOS Roms. When the computer boots up are the GEM menus also in German? I brought a MEGA STe from some one in Switzerland, this was also a German machine, I got a new keyboard from best electronics and a set of TOS ROM chips from Ebay. With the 1040ste you would need the UK ROMS and a STe keyboard. (Roms only needed if the OS is GERMAN). You will have to take the case off to fit both these items....
